    The Forty-fourth of 108 Gates Of Dharma Illumination

    The Forty-fourth Gate: right means.

    Right means are a gate of Dharma illumination; for they are accompanied by right conduct.(Nishijima/Cross)
    Right skillful means is a gate of realizing Dharma; it embodies right action. (Tanahashi)

    Gate Gatha:
    May we, together with all buddhas;
    Actualize pure intentions,
    That we may be assured of right conduct.

    Reflection Prompts:
    1. In what way are Right Means accompanied by right Conduct?
    2. How does Right skillful Means embody Right Action?
    3. Are right Conduct and Action the same thing?

    Capping Verse:
    Balancing the what
    With the how
    We act as Buddha
